This paper discuss the operational efficiency of Perishable Product Supply Chain (PPSC) in context of Petri Net (PN) modeling technique. The operational efficiency is classified into: inventory management, logistics, information sharing and supply chain risk among different stages of supply chain with coordination and monitoring through traceability and PPSC risk management. This classification of operational efficiency will allow the industrial practitioners and academicians to decide on the suitable petri net technique for the problem identified. This paper discuss the research directions of application of Petri Net in PPSC (operational efficiency). In addition, paper provides future directions for operational efficiency in PPSC and are as follows: 1) modelling PPSC with uncertainty, 2) reducing complexity in PPSC, 3) integration of PN modelling with emerging technology, 4) PN involvement in information flow and traceability and 5) application of PN modelling in decision making.
